Hi there,
I currently live in South Africa and my fiancée has been offered a job in Gouda, the Netherlands. We have to decide if we want to accept the offer before next week, and if we do we will both be moving to Gouda by January next year.
My fiancee is a mechanical engineer, with 10 moths working experience (he completed his degree last year). The salary they are offering him is 3000 euros per month. This is for the time that he will be on probation, and after a year he has the possibility of getting a raise. I have looked around on various websites to see what the living costs is in the Netherlands (especially accomodation - renting). I will not be working (only possibly at a later stage). And I also should mention that we are both 26 years old and dont have any children - its just the two of us.
My question is: Is 3000 euros enough for both of us to start out with?
I will greatly appreciate anyone's (especially if you're living in the netherlands) advice!

Annelise,
The average annual income per household in 2007 is expected to be EUR30164 per year. (Also known as Modaal inkomen - do a google search for this term)
3k per month is not very high, BUT considering your fiance has almost no working experience (or a year by the time you get here) it is not a bad starting salary.
Will you be able to survive on this? I think it is possible - depending on what you expect. Once again consider that this salary is the average for a household. Especially if the fiance qualifies for the 30% ruling.

it will not be easy and you wont have much money for international travel etc.
Coffee 3-5 eur
mid range meal: 15-20 eur
groceries for 1 per week: 40-50 eur
movie : 9 eur
dvd rental: 4 eur
